About The Position

The purpose of this position is to provide 24-hour accountability for coordination of the safe provision of quality patient care on the inpatient unit for women, families and children. Responsibilities include but are not limited to: Operational functions include providing for safe 24-hour staffing, financial stewardship, respectful environment of care for staff and patients, based on person-centered principles. Quality and Safety. Will ensure that environment is non-punitive and engages staff, providers and patients to uncover and speak up about safety concerns. Intentional efforts of continual process improvement that enhances the safety and quality of patient care and the patient care environment. Supervisory functions include recruiting, interviewing, evaluating, team development, coaching, counseling, and terminating staff for an overall efficient running operation. Students are welcome in our care environment and will be treated as future colleagues and offered safe intentional learning opportunities. The Supervisor will develop and model healing relationships with neonatal, pediatric, adolescent, adult, and geriatric patients, families and visitors. They, along with the Inpatient Services Director will develop key working relationships with LRH clinical staff, support departments, referral agencies, volunteers, APPs and Physicians. The supervisor must have excellent problem-solving and critical thinking skills, must be able work cooperatively with teams, demonstrate public relation skills, and exercise good judgement. Effective communication skills are essential for this position. Hours/Shifts This is a full time, working supervisory role, with requirement to work eight shifts within a six week schedule.
